Specifications
Typical for 25 °C unless otherwise specified.
Specifications in italic text are guaranteed by design.
Analog input
Table 1. Analog input specifications
Parameter
Specification
A/D converter type
7800
Resolution
12 bits
Number of channels
8 differential or 16 single-ended, software selectable
Input ranges
Bipolar:
±10 V, ±5 V, ±2.5 V, ±1.25 V
Unipolar:
0 to 10 V, 0 to 5 V, 0 to 2.5 V, 0 to 1.25 V
Software selectable
A/D pacing
Programmable: internal counter or external source (A/D External Pacer) or
software polled
Burst mode
Software selectable option, burst rate = 3 µs
A/D trigger sources
External digital: A/D External Trigger
A/D triggering modes
External digital: Software enabled, rising edge, hardware trigger
Pre-trigger:
Unlimited pre- and post-trigger samples. Total # of
samples must be > 512.
Data transfer
From 1024 sample FIFO via REPINSW, interrupt or software polled
A/D conversion time
3 µs
Throughput
330 kHz min
Relative accuracy
±1.5 LSB
Differential linearity error
±0.75 LSB
Integral linearity error
±0.5 LSB typ, ±1.5 LSB max
Gain error (relative to calibration reference) ± 0.02% of reading max
No missing codes guaranteed
12 bits
Gain drift (A/D specs)
±6 ppm/°C
Zero drift (A/D specs)
±1 ppm/°C
Common mode range
±10 V
CMRR @ 60 Hz
70 dB
Input leakage current
200 nA
Input impedance
10 MOhm, min
Absolute maximum input voltage
±35 V
Noise distribution:
Rate = 1-330 KHz, average % ± 2 bins, average % ±1 bin, average # bins
All ranges:
100% / 100% / 3 bins
